Please remove if not allowed. in addition to some pure metallic cubes that I've recently purchased, I have over 1,500 mineral specimens representing over 320 different species this is a personally collected crystal of betafite from Bancroft, Ontario. When I was in 8th grade, we went on a school science field trip to Bancroft to collect radioactive minerals as well as apatite, richterite and others. Betafite is a member of the pyrochlore group and contains thorium, titanium, uranium and niobium. Hand sample of three incredibly rare minerals: Decrespignyite, Paratooite and Kamphaugite from the Paratoo copper mine in Australia. Decrespignyite is only found at this location and nowhere else on Earth. This mineral contains a broad range of rare earth elements. From my personal collection.

Periodic Table 49.8% Zirconium by Mass

Thumbnail
gallery
17 Upvotes

Zircon crystals from Brazil

Weakly Radioactive due to isomorphic substitution:

During the crystal's formation deep in the earth, trace amounts of Uranium and Thorium substitute for Zirconium within the crystal's molecular lattice. Because Uranium and Thorium ions share a similar size and electrical charge to Zirconium, they fit perfectly into the structure. Over time, the natural decay of these trapped trace elements emits very low levels of radiation, making the specimen weakly radioactive.
